Can you scare a person to death?

Yes, you can scare someone to death. When someone is scared, their body produces a chemical called Adrenaline. Adrenaline is a naturally produced chemical that does all sorts of things. Adrenaline makes your heart beat faster, muscles function more efficiently, etc. However, too much of this chemical can cause death, so theoretically, yes, even though it would be very hard to do so, you can scare someone to death.


Can you die of fear?

Yes, it is possible. The heart can be shocked by too much adrenaline that the body can release when scared. Although this mainly can happen to the elderly or someone with a heart condition rather than a healthy individual.
